ELYRIA, OHIO – June 15, 2026 – RIDGID®, a part of Emerson’s professional tools portfolio, welcomed 68 students to its global headquarters in Elyria, Ohio, for its sixth annual “We Love STEM Day,” a hands-on program that introduces young learners to the role STEM plays in manufacturing and skilled trades careers.

 

Designed for students in kindergarten through eighth grade, the program showed how mechanical and electrical engineering, along with energy and natural resources, support modern manufacturing. Through STEM activities, students strengthened core science and engineering skills while exploring the legacy of American innovation. In honor of America’s 250th anniversary, each activity connected to an influential inventor, including Benjamin Franklin, Thomas Edison and the Wright brothers, linking historic breakthroughs to today’s technologies.

 

“Early exposure to STEM helps students see how problem-solving, innovation and teamwork translate into careers in manufacturing and the skilled trades,” said Stacey Varuolo, event chair and chapter lead, RIDGID Women’s Impact Network for Emerson. “We Love STEM Day gives them a hands-on introduction to the technologies and skills that power our industry.”

About RIDGID

For more than 100 years, RIDGID has been delivering plumbing, mechanical and HVAC tools designed to help trade professionals install and maintain the world’s infrastructure with more ease and efficiency. Inventing the

modern-day pipe wrench in 1923, RIDGID today has more than 100 patents and 300 products that are trusted by professionals in over 140 countries. Headquartered in Elyria, Ohio, RIDGID is a part of the Emerson professional tools portfolio that also includes Greenlee® and Klauke®. Learn more, visit RIDGID.com.
